Trump's FTC chairman chides Apple boss Tim Cook for content of Apple news feed
The chairman of the Federal Trade Commission, Andrew Ferguson, has written to Apple CEO Tim Cook to express concerns that Apple News is suppressing content from conservative news outlets. Ferguson’s complaint follows a report by the Media Research Center alleging that the news feed disproportionately features “leftist” sources while omitting prominent conservative media. This criticism comes despite Cook’s attendance at President Trump’s second term inauguration.
